為什么CAD文字的高度和特性中的高度不一樣?為什么輸入文字時(shí)顯得特別大或輸入后文字消失了?
今天群里有人問(wèn)了一個(gè)問(wèn)題,說(shuō)為什么在特性面板里看到多行文字的高度是200,但進(jìn)入多行文字編輯器中看文字高度只有20,如下圖所示。
其實(shí)這個(gè)問(wèn)題并不奇怪,之前的文章講過(guò)類(lèi)似的問(wèn)題,只是那些人遇到的現象更奇怪。比如輸入時(shí)文字顯得特別大,如下圖所示是輸入300的字體,但按鼠標左鍵確認后文字大小就會(huì )恢復正常。
為什么多行文字實(shí)際高度和特性面板中顯示得不一樣,或者輸入的時(shí)候變得異常大呢?
估計有不少人遇到過(guò)類(lèi)似情況,這個(gè)問(wèn)題很容易重現,我覺(jué)得這算是CAD的一個(gè)BUG,但如果知道了問(wèn)題產(chǎn)生的原因的話(huà),也會(huì )覺(jué)得比較合理。
下面我們不妨看一下為什么會(huì )如此,應該如何解決此問(wèn)題。
一、為什么多行文字和特性面板中看到的字高不一致?
多行文字對象本身有一個(gè)高度設置,這個(gè)高度最好在寫(xiě)多行文字前設置好,在進(jìn)入多行文字編輯器后可以設置字符的文字高度,而且不同字符可以設置成不同高度,這個(gè)高度會(huì )按倍數來(lái)記錄,如下圖所示。
上面這個(gè)多行文字的默認高度是2.5,CAD三個(gè)字母的高度設置為30,是2.5的12倍,因此記錄成H12x,后面兩個(gè)漢字的高度是20,是30的2/3,因此高度被記錄為H0.66667x。
文章開(kāi)頭網(wǎng)友的截圖中特性面板其實(shí)可以看到內容中的高度倍數,已經(jīng)可以解釋為什么特性面板文字高度顯示200,多行文字編輯器中是20,倍數就是H0.1x,如下圖所示。
如果想不出現這個(gè)問(wèn)題,就需要在創(chuàng )建多行文字前設置好文字高度。
多行文字字高的設置方法
CAD多行文字編碼講解
二、為什么多行文字輸入的時(shí)候顯得特別大或輸入后變得特別???
CAD為了方便大家編輯文字,當判斷文字在圖中顯示比較小,看不清的時(shí)候,就會(huì )將文字放大;當文字旋轉角度比較大,看起來(lái)比較費勁的時(shí)候,也會(huì )將文字旋轉回水平方向,這種現象大家應該經(jīng)??吹?,也不會(huì )覺(jué)得奇怪。
CAD的多行文字編輯器中的WYSIWYG是什么意思?
那文字會(huì )顯得超大呢?我們不妨通過(guò)下面的視頻來(lái)看一下。
為什么會(huì )這樣呢?
在上面的視頻中我畫(huà)了一個(gè)300長(cháng)的標注作為參考,當輸入多行文字的時(shí)候,文字的默認高度是2.5,此時(shí)如果直接輸入文字,在多行文字編輯器里文字是可見(jiàn)的,其實(shí)這種情況下文字已經(jīng)被放大,高度已經(jīng)不止2.5了,可能已經(jīng)被放大了好幾倍,此時(shí)我們在多行文字編輯器里將文字高度改成300,CAD仍按照2.5高度來(lái)判斷和放大,放大倍數并沒(méi)有變回去,高度300的文字又被放大了好幾倍,顯示高度遠超300,因此顯得特別大。
視頻中只是為了更清楚地說(shuō)明現象,先輸入了幾個(gè)高度為2.5的字符。如果我們在進(jìn)入多行文字編輯器后直接將高度改成300后再輸入文字,現象是一樣的。這是因為在打開(kāi)多行文字編輯器時(shí)默認高度是2.5,CAD為了保證輸入文字能看得見(jiàn),已經(jīng)根據視圖的范圍放大了。
三、如何解決上面的這些問(wèn)題
那怎么解決這些問(wèn)題呢?解決辦法有兩種:
1、在書(shū)寫(xiě)多行文字之前線(xiàn)設置文字高度
設置文字高度的方法也有兩種:
(1)輸入多行文字的時(shí)候設置高度。
在書(shū)寫(xiě)多行文字時(shí)會(huì )先讓我們框選范圍,在確定第一個(gè)角點(diǎn)后,確定另一個(gè)角點(diǎn)前,命令行會(huì )顯示一些參數,此時(shí)是可以設置多行文字的高度的。輸入H,回車(chē),輸入300,再回車(chē),如下圖所示。
設置高度為300后,我們從樣例文字都可以看出來(lái)文字顯示已經(jīng)正常了,因為300高的文字無(wú)需放大就可以正常顯示了。
(2)直接設置文字高度的變量
CAD提供了一個(gè)設置默認文字高度的變量TEXTSIZE。輸入TEXTSIZE回車(chē),輸入300,回車(chē)。就可以將文字高度的預設值變成300,對于單行文字和多行文字都有效。
這是建議使用的方法!
2、打開(kāi)所見(jiàn)即所得WYSIWYG
上面說(shuō)了多行文字輸入和編輯的時(shí)候,文字過(guò)小會(huì )自動(dòng)放大,這種效果是可以關(guān)閉的,只需要打開(kāi)多行文字的所見(jiàn)及所得就可以。在多行文字編輯器的右鍵菜單勾選“始終顯示為WYSIWYG”如下圖所示。
如果圖紙已經(jīng)寫(xiě)好的文字在編輯的時(shí)候出現類(lèi)似問(wèn)題,可以到多行文字里全選后刪除格式,然后在特性面板(CTRL+1)里重新設置高度,當然也可以簡(jiǎn)單地打開(kāi)WYSIWYG的效果。
-
Origin(Pro):學(xué)習版的窗口限制【數據繪圖】 2020-08-07
-
如何卸載Aspen Plus并再重新安裝,這篇文章告訴你! 2020-05-29
-
OriginPro:學(xué)習版申請及過(guò)期激活方法【數據繪圖】 2020-08-06
-
CAD視口的邊框線(xiàn)看不到也選不中是怎么回事,怎么解決? 2020-06-04
-
教程 | Origin從DSC計算焓和比熱容 2020-08-31
-
如何評價(jià)擬合效果-Origin(Pro)數據擬合系列教程【數據繪圖】 2020-08-06
-
CAD外部參照無(wú)法綁定怎么辦? 2020-06-03
-
CAD中如何將布局連帶視口中的內容復制到另一張圖中? 2020-07-03